High accuracy track distance measuring system - has regularly spaced repeaters energised at different frequencies for error correction of locomotive distance measurement

摘要
The track-distance signalling and correction system consists of an inductive cable radiator laid the length of the track with a corresponding receiver and demodulator in the locomotive. At regular intervals along the track are distance markers comprising repeaters or transponders each of which is fed with a different low-frequency signal. The change of frequency at each repeater point is detected by the locomotive and this signal is used for error correction of the existing track-distance measuring system in the locomotive. Since the sequence of different frequencies detected depends on the direction of travel of the locomotive, this parameter also may be determined from this type of system.
